What will you be doing in this role?

  • Compile and forward contracting requirements & paperwork to advisors for completion
  • Assist advisor with questions and completion of contract paperwork
  • Provide support for Apexa On-boarding
  • Maintain regular communication with advisor throughout the contracting process to completion
  • Forward contract approval / issued code to advisor and Case Manager (as applicable)
  • Work directly with multiple insurance carriers across Canada
  • Provide superior customer support for internal and external partners
  • Work with Branch Office Coordinators (BOC) regarding advisor walk-in questions
  • Maintain a full understanding of contracting, transfers, regulatory licensing, compliance and privacy rules / laws, contract changes, transfers of business and consolidations
  • Build and maintain collaborative and constructive working relationships (internally and externally)
  • Communicate effectively with colleagues, insurance carriers, advisors and clients
  • Work extensively on back office systems (WealthServ, Sentry File, Insurance Carrier websites, APEXA)
  • Responsible for maintaining an organized filing system for easy referral and retrieval
  • Back up and vacation coverage as required
  • Ensure Service Level Standards are maintained
  • Perform any other duties as assigned
